Output 61ce903cc28b21ffddc0bae770da62cb477e41d4a80dde6e95f915696b27c9ff:5

value
1555091
script pubkey
OP_0 OP_PUSHBYTES_20 1086d66b73e36d9c93f5b5aa4e86bfe02dc9fd23
address
bc1qzzrdv6mnudkeeyl4kk4yap4luqkunlfrux8hul
transaction
61ce903cc28b21ffddc0bae770da62cb477e41d4a80dde6e95f915696b27c9ff
confirmations
25878
spent
true